Technical field
The present invention relates to pistol technical fields, more particularly to a kind of manual safety mechanism of firing pin parallel-moving type pistol.
Background technique
Domestic and international most of pistol at present is provided with manual guarantor to guarantee the safety of firearms in use Dangerous mechanism participates in type selecting to apply compulsory insurance measure to pistol, such as during U.S. army's newest pistol M17 pistol type selecting A few money pistol schemes be equipped with manual safety, target is that continue your company of German Xi Ge-is with P320 pistol in final type selecting Basis adds manual safety and improved pistol scheme, it can be seen that the safety of pistol is extremely closed in the manual safety mechanism of pistol It is important, and the safety in utilization of pistol is then more significant to police and other civilian applicable objects.

Specific embodiment
Invention is further explained with reference to the accompanying drawing, and in attached drawing, 1- insurance, 2- hinders iron, and 3- hinders iron spring, 4- resistance Iron spring abutment, 5- actuating lever, 6- actuating lever spring, 7- transmitter block, 8- pull rod, 9- trigger, 10- gunlock, 11- firing pin, 12- are hit Needle safety axis, 13- casing, 101- insure handle, 102- safety axis, 103- positioning shaft shoulder, 104- insurance positioning tooth, 105- resistance Iron/actuating lever recessing groove, 106- actuating lever indent, 107- orient mounting groove, and 108- gunlock insures tooth, and 10401- insurance is fixed Position tooth crest cusp, 201- collar aperture, 202- hinder iron and insure tooth, 203- safety axis recessing groove, and 204- holds spring slot, and 205- hinders iron spring Seat recessing groove, 206- resistance definitely plane, 207- hinder iron spring abutment confined planes, 401- collar aperture, and 402- insures locating slot, 403- circlip Lug, 404- hinder iron spring abutment limiting tooth, the non-insured state locating slot of 40201-, 40202- safety position locating slot, in 40203- Between cusp, 501- collar aperture, 502- actuating lever insure tooth, 503- safety axis recessing groove, 504- actuating lever positioning surface, 505- Actuating lever spring card slot, 701- insure handle recessing groove, 702- insurance orientation mounting groove, 703- trigger axis hole, 704- resistance iron axis Hole, 1001- gunlock safety groove.
As shown in Fig. 1 to Fig. 6, a kind of manual safety mechanism of firing pin parallel-moving type pistol, including insurance 1, resistance iron 2, resistance iron Spring 3, resistance iron spring abutment 4, actuating lever 5, actuating lever spring 6, transmitter block 7 and gunlock 10, the insurance 1 are rotatably installed in In insurance axis hole 703 on the transmitter block 7, the resistance iron 2, actuating lever 5, resistance iron spring abutment 4 are on the transmitter block 7 Resistance iron axis hole 704 is that axle center is rotatably installed on transmitter block 7, and the resistance iron spring 3 and actuating lever spring 6 are two torsions Spring, the spiral parts of two torsional springs around 704 axle center of resistance iron axis hole, and respective two spring feet be respectively acting on resistance iron spring abutment 4, Hinder iron 2 and resistance iron spring abutment 4, actuating lever 5, the gunlock 10 be located above transmitter block 7, can be on transmitter block 7 before After slide.
The insurance 1 is symmetrically arranged with the shaft-like structure of insurance handle 101 for both ends, is equipped between two sides insurance handle 101 Safety axis 102, the safety axis 102 are a multi-diameter shaft, and the middle part of axis is thicker, and both ends are thinner, the thick axis in the middle part and both ends Thin axis intersection sets that there are two square positioning shaft shoulder 103,103 position of two sides positioning shaft shoulder bilateral symmetry, two positioning shaft shoulders 103 The distance between, i.e., the length L1 of the thick axis in middle part and the size relationship of 7 left and right sides wall inner wall spacing H1 of transmitter block are answered Meet L1=H1, left and right positioning shaft shoulder 103 is realized to insurance 1 with the interaction of the left and right inner sidewall of transmitter block 7 in transmitter Left and right positioning on seat 7, the middle part of thick axis are equipped with insurance positioning tooth 104, the thick axial cylindrical face in two sides of the insurance positioning tooth 104 On be respectively provided with a resistance iron/actuating lever recessing groove 105, the thick axial cylindrical face in right side of insurance positioning tooth 104 is additionally provided with one and hits Send out lever indent 106, the cylindrical surface of the thick axis in middle part and it is described resistance iron 2 and actuating lever 5 on set by resistance definitely plane 206 and hit Hair lever positioning surface 504 is in contact, and assembles posture to resistance iron 2 and actuating lever 5 and limits, when non-insured state, pulls and pull Machine 9 makes pull rod 8 travel forward, and actuating lever 5 and the upper end of resistance iron 2 is successively driven to turn over, the resistance iron/actuating lever Set safety axis recessing groove 203/503 enables to hinder iron 2 and actuating lever 5 on recessing groove 105 and resistance iron 2 and actuating lever 5 Enough angles of enough turning over simultaneously finally free firing pin 11, to fire bullet, when safety position the cylindrical surface of the thick axis it is logical Cross the restriction effect resistance to resistance iron insurance tooth 202 set on the resistance iron 2 and actuating lever 5 and actuating lever insurance tooth 502 It only hinders iron 2 and actuating lever 5 is turned over, prevent actuating lever 5 that cannot free firing pin 11, institute from releasing firing pin insurance, resistance iron 2 It states and is equipped with orientation mounting groove 107 above the thin axial cylindrical face on safety axis 102 at left and right positioning shaft shoulder 103, the orientation installation 107 groove width H2 of slot and 7 side wall wall thickness H 3 of transmitter block should meet size relationship H2 > H3, and installation is oriented described in arranged on left and right sides Between slot 107 and insurance handle 101, every side is respectively provided with a gunlock insurance tooth 108.
2 top of resistance iron is equipped with collar aperture 201, and resistance 2 rear portion of iron is equipped with resistance iron and insures tooth 202, and the resistance iron insures tooth 202 fronts are equipped with safety axis recessing groove 203, are equipped in resistance iron 2 and hold spring slot 204 and resistance iron spring abutment recessing groove 205, hinder 2 lower part of iron Rear is equipped with resistance definitely plane 206, and 201 back upper place of collar aperture is equipped with resistance iron spring abutment confined planes 207.
5 top of actuating lever is equipped with collar aperture 501, and rear portion is equipped with actuating lever and insures tooth 502, the actuating lever Insure and be equipped with safety axis recessing groove 503 in front of tooth 502,5 lower part rear of actuating lever is equipped with actuating lever positioning surface 504, percussion 5 front described sleeve pipe hole of lever, 501 front upper place is equipped with actuating lever spring card slot 505.
Collar aperture 401 is equipped in the middle part of the resistance iron spring abutment 4, resistance 4 rear portion of iron spring abutment is equipped with the insurance locating slot in " M " shape 402, the insurance locating slot 402 is acted on insurance positioning tooth 104 set in the insurance 1, and insurance 1 is made to shoot and insure Energy firm positioning when state, resistance 4 front part sides of iron spring abutment are equipped with circlip lug 403, and the circlip lug 403 makes the resistance iron Spring 3 and actuating lever spring 6 are securely captured on resistance iron spring abutment 4, and resistance 4 top described sleeve pipe hole of iron spring abutment, 401 back upper place is equipped with resistance Iron spring abutment limiting tooth 404 is passing through set by the resistance iron 2, actuating lever 5, resistance iron spring abutment 4, resistance iron spring 3 and actuating lever spring 6 When the resistance iron component preassembled condition that pipe 13 forms, the resistance iron spring abutment limiting tooth 404 is the same as resistance iron spring abutment set on the resistance iron 2 Confined planes 207 be interlocked contact make hinder iron component package in resistance iron spring 3 and actuating lever spring 6 be in spring force preloading condition, After the insurance 1 is packed into the insurance axis hole 703 of transmitter block 7, set insurance positioning tooth 104 is caught in resistance iron spring abutment 4 in insurance 1 Rear portion " M " shape is insured in locating slot 402, and jacking up resistance 4 rear portion of iron spring abutment overturns resistance iron spring abutment 4 forward, hinders institute on iron spring abutment 4 Handicapping iron spring abutment limiting tooth 404 disengages fastening with resistance iron spring abutment confined planes 207 set on the resistance iron 2, makes the resistance The spring force of iron spring 3 and actuating lever spring 6 substantially acts on resistance iron 2, actuating lever 5 and insurance 1 by hindering iron spring abutment 4, and Keep " M " shape insurance locating slot 402 for hindering the setting of 4 rear portion of iron spring abutment tight with the insurance positioning tooth 104 set in insurance 1 Contiguity touching fastens, thus to 1 reliable location is insured.
The transmitter block 7 is the installation frame of each part of manual safety mechanism involved by the present invention, and transmitter block 7 is left and right Two sidewalls are equipped with insurance handle recessing groove 701, insurance axis hole 703, resistance iron axis hole 704 and are connected to insurance handle recessing groove 701 Insurance with insurance axis hole 703 orients mounting groove 702, both ends on the aperture d1 and the safety axis 102 of the insurance axis hole 703 The size relationship of the diameter of axle D2 of thin axis should meet d1=D2, the slot of set insurance orientation mounting groove 702 on the transmitter block 7 Wide h4 should meet size relationship h4=H5, transmitter block 7 with the wide H5 of slot bottom of orientation mounting groove 107 set in the insurance 1 Upper set insurance orientation mounting groove 702 can make insurance 1 with specific posture (i.e. orientation mounting groove 107 and insurance orientation peace Tankage 702 is parallel) it is packed into insurance axis hole 703 by the insurance handle recessing groove 701, and can make to be packed into insurance axis hole 703 In in running order insurance 1 rotate flexibly, radial reliable location.
10 lower part of gunlock corresponds to the position that the insurance 1 is equipped with gunlock insurance tooth 108, is equipped with gunlock safety groove 1001, when the insurance 1 is in safety position, set gunlock insurance tooth 108 is caught in the gunlock safety groove 1001 in insurance 1 Interior, carrying out locking to gunlock 10 makes gunlock 10 can not post-tensioning.
The resistance iron spring 3 and actuating lever spring 6 are both by directly acting on the resistance iron 2, actuating lever 5 and resistance iron spring abutment 4, it is resetted in time after so that resistance iron 2 and 5 upper end of actuating lever is turned over, resistance iron spring abutment 4 is made to have the tendency that turning over, further through It hinders 4 indirectly-acting of iron spring abutment and insures 1 in described, make " M " shape insurance locating slot 402 for hindering the setting of 4 rear portion of iron spring abutment with guarantor The set insurance positioning tooth 104, which is in close contact, on danger 1 fastens, and reliable location insurance 1.
Pistol is carried out (to be closed and protected by non-insured state (open and insure, the state that pistol can normally be shot) to safety position Danger, the state that pistol can not be shot) conversion when, push insurance handle 101 that insurance is made 1 to turn over, set insurance is fixed in insurance 1 Position tooth 104 slides into safety position out of non-insured state locating slot 40201 that hinder the insurance locating slot 402 of " M " shape set by iron spring abutment 4 In locating slot 40202, completes non-insured state to safety position and convert;When being converted by safety position to non-insured state, stir Insurance handle 101 overturns insurance 1 forward, and set insurance positioning tooth 104 is fixed from the insurance of " M " shape set by iron spring abutment 4 is hindered in insurance 1 It is slid into non-insured state locating slot 40201 in the safety position locating slot 40202 of position slot 402, completes safety position to non-guarantor Dangerous state conversion.
The trigger 9 of pistol, the resistance iron insurance tooth 202 and percussion thick stick at resistance 2 rear portion of iron are pulled in insurance 1 when being in safety position 5 rear portion of bar actuating lever insurance tooth 502 because by insurance 1 insure the thick axis of axis 102 cylindrical surface limit, make 5 nothing of actuating lever Method turns over to jack firing pin safety plate 12 under the action of pull rod 8 to release firing pin insurance and push resistance iron 2 backward Overturning hinders iron 2 and can not voluntarily turn over and free firing pin 11 to free firing pin 11, while insuring the gunlock being arranged on 1 and protecting Dangerous tooth 108, which is caught in gunlock safety groove 1001 set on gunlock 10, prevents gunlock 10 from pulling back the locking of gunlock 10, makes Gunlock 10, resistance iron 2 and actuating lever 5 are steadily constrained and are limited, and firing pin insurance cannot be released, and firing pin 11 is stablized by resistance iron 2 Ground hooks and can not free and fire bullet, since actuating lever 5 is limited, so that being associated movement by pull rod briar tooth Pull rod 8 and trigger 9 are also limited and constrain, and trigger 9 can not be pulled.
Particularly, when pistol is in " partly insuring " state, i.e., insurance handle 101, which is in open, insures and closes insurance Between position when, insurance positioning tooth at the top of cusp 10401 withstand on " M " shape insurance locating slot 402 in non-insured state locating slot On intermediate cusp 40203 between 40201 and safety position locating slot 40202, and in the work of resistance iron spring 3 and actuating lever spring 6 With it is lower be in extremely unstable static balancing state, cocking 9, when actuating lever 5 being made to turn over, 5 rear portion of actuating lever Actuating lever insurance tooth 502 be pressed on safety axis 102 set 106 groove bottom rear portion of actuating lever indent, to safety axis 102 Apply the torque for making insurance 1 turn over, to break extremely unstable " half insures " state, skips to insurance 1 voluntarily Safety position.According to mechanics standing balance relevant knowledge and the practical operation experience of this manual safety mechanism model machine, so-called " half Insurance " state only user intentionally, very purposely " search " under " look for " and arriving, and difficulty is very big.Therefore it is of the invention skilful Wonderful structure design ensure that by reducing the probability and reliable releasing " half insures " dual measure of state that " partly insuring " state occurs The tight security of manual safety mechanism.
When manual safety mechanism according to the present invention is assembled, resistance iron component (the resistance iron component finished will have first been pre-installed Assembly method is referring to patent " a method of assembly pistol hinder iron component ") the resistance iron axis of transmitter block 7 is packed by resistance iron axis In hole 704, the side insurance handle 101 for insuring 1 is then passed through into the insurance handle recessing groove 701 of transmitter block 7, and make to insure Axis 102 is located at the back lower place of resistance iron component, then rotating insurance 1 is in the groove bottom of the orientation mounting groove 107 on safety axis 102 Vertical state is simultaneously parallel with the insurance orientation mounting groove 702 on transmitter block 7, and then mobile insurance 1 will insure 1 straight up It is fitted into insurance axis hole 703 by insurance orientation mounting groove 702, finally overturning insurance 1 forward, the insurance on safety axis 102 is fixed The rear portion that the facet (being now in heeling condition) of position 104 front of tooth voluntarily jacks up resistance iron spring abutment 4 keeps insurance positioning tooth 104 sliding Enter in " M " shape insurance locating slot 402, so far completes the assembly of the manual safety mechanism;When manual safety mechanism decomposes, first press Resistance 4 front of iron spring abutment overturns it forward, and then back rotation insurance 1 makes to insure positioning tooth 104 from " M " shape insurance locating slot It is produced in 402, and keeps the groove bottom for orienting mounting groove 107 on safety axis 102 in a vertical state, moving down insurance 1 will Insurance 1 moves in insurance handle recessing groove 701 from insurance axis hole 703, finally will insurance 1 and resistance iron component from transmitter block 7 On remove, complete manual safety mechanism decomposition.
